概述
Unif前端框架是一款基于Vue.js开发的全栈框架,旨在为开发者提供一套简洁、高效、跨平台的应用开发解决方案。通过Unif,开发者可以编写一套代码,实现Web、小程序、移动端等多种平台的应用开发,大大提高开发效率,降低开发成本。
Unif框架特点
1. 跨平台开发
Unif框架支持多平台开发,包括Web、小程序、移动端等,开发者只需编写一套代码,即可实现多平台部署。
2. 高效开发
Unif框架提供丰富的组件和工具链,帮助开发者快速搭建应用架构,提高开发效率。
3. 轻松上手
Unif框架基于Vue.js开发,对于熟悉Vue.js的开发者来说,上手更加容易。
4. 优雅的API设计
Unif框架提供简洁、易用的API,方便开发者快速掌握框架的使用。
Unif框架快速上手
1. 安装
首先,您需要在您的开发环境中安装Node.js和npm(Node.js包管理器)。然后,通过以下命令安装Unif框架:
npm install -g unif-cli
2. 创建项目
安装完成后,您可以使用以下命令创建一个新的Unif项目:
unif init my-project
3. 目录结构
Unif项目的目录结构如下:
my-project/
├── src/
│ ├── components/ # 组件目录
│ ├── views/ # 视图目录
│ ├── router/ # 路由目录
│ ├── store/ # 状态管理目录
│ └── App.vue # 根组件
├── package.json
├── README.md
└── ...
4. 编写代码
在项目中,您可以根据需要创建组件、视图、路由等文件。以下是一个简单的组件示例:
<template>
<div>
<h1>你好,Unif框架!</h1>
</div>
</template>
<script>
export default {
name: 'HelloWorld',
}
</script>
<style scoped>
h1 {
color: #42b983;
}
</style>
5. 运行项目
在项目目录下,执行以下命令启动开发服务器:
npm run dev
Unif框架技术要点
1. 组件化开发
Unif框架采用组件化开发模式,将应用拆分为多个独立的组件,提高代码复用性和可维护性。
2. 路由管理
Unif框架内置Vue Router,方便开发者进行路由管理。
3. 状态管理
Unif框架使用Vuex进行状态管理,实现数据共享和状态同步。
4. 网络请求
Unif框架提供axios库,方便开发者进行网络请求。
5. CSS预处理器
Unif框架支持Sass、Less等CSS预处理器,提高样式编写效率。
总结
Unif前端框架是一款高效、易用的全栈框架,适用于各种类型的前端开发项目。通过Unif框架,开发者可以轻松上手,快速开发,告别繁琐编程。